Steam Users Want This Helpful Feature Added to the Client

News RoomBy News Room29 December 20254 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email
Steam Users Want This Helpful Feature Added to the Client

A new feature for the Steam store proposed by a fan could be a huge addition to the client, allowing users to track the prices of games over time. The massive online marketplace managed by Valve has grown into one of gaming’s biggest and most iconic storefronts over its storied 23-year-long lifespan, hosting more than 100,000 games. Steam boasts tens of millions of players using the client every day, with Valve even expanding the storefront into its own handheld device and an upcoming home console. Steam has also undergone plenty of changes throughout its history.

Steam has gone through a multitude of revisions since its inception, with Valve constantly looking to improve the client. Steam boasts everything from official mod support with the Steam Workshop, a virtual reality-focused client in SteamVR, and lots more for fans to enjoy. The growth of Steam as an online marketplace has also led the company to push for more changes aimed at protecting its users, launching an age verification system for Steam in the UK. Now, a new feature proposed by a Steam fan could be a major boon to gamers looking to score a deal on the storefront.

Consumer-Friendly Steam Feature is an Absolute Game-Changer

Steam has always been considered a consumer-friendly platform by users, but this new feature takes it to a whole other level entirely.

Steam Users Want Valve to Add Price History

A new Steam feature proposed by Reddit user kevinttan would make the process of shopping on Steam even easier for many fans. The post suggests that Steam should add a price history tracker to store pages for games hosted on the platform, similar to the charts used by popular Steam aggregator SteamDB. The example chart on display within the post details an extended history of the game, using Stardew Valley as an example, showing different times its price has dropped as a result of a sale. Steam currently does not include any official method to see how the price of a game has changed over time.

While fans universally agreed that the price history update would be a positive for consumers, many doubted its implementation. Several users pointed out the potential downsides for Valve and developers on Steam, with readily available price histories likely causing fans to wait to purchase games. One fan pointed out the possibility of developers growing “hesitant to run big sales,” affecting the massive discounts during Steam’s frequent sales. Other users did point out that many third-party sites already feature price history charts, however, including the previously-mentioned SteamDB. One fan even cited a set of European laws, requiring online storefronts to depict the lowest price of a product from 30 days prior to advertising price reductions.

Steam’s Big Sales Are A Major Draw for Fans

Steam’s proposed price history chart comes as the platform’s sales are often a major event for fans on the platform. Steam’s Summer Sale is typically the client’s biggest discount event of the year, with the annual sale marking down thousands of games for a limited time. The marketplace has expanded its promotional discounts far beyond the Summer Sale, running similar events in the Fall, holiday season, and plenty more throughout the year. Steam is also currently hosting its annual Winter Sale, with a plethora of games marked down until January 5.
